Is it possible the temp sensors in the 6700 could either be reporting a wrong reading which is causing the fans to turn on sporadically? Setting up for the Salmon Run this morning and I notice when the fans kick on the temp reading on DDUtil is about 169 degrees C...when they shut off it reads 28 degrees. Seems like a huge swing and I cannot imagine the radio operating anything over 80 degrees C. Thanks Greg AB7R
